Common Unlodctr.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with unlodctr.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to unlodctr.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Error 0xc0000142: This error message appears when an application wasn't able to start correctly, often due to issues in the software itself, corrupted files, or problems with Windows registry.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error message shows up when the system lacks the necessary resources to carry out the service requested, possibly due to overuse of system memory or high CPU usage.
  • Access is Denied: This error usually comes up due to permission issues. It indicates that the user does not have the necessary rights to execute a certain .exe file.
  • Unlodctr.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error message indicates that Windows cannot run unlodctr.exe because it's either corrupted, or the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This warning appears when the system experiences a fatal error resulting in a system crash. Potential causes could include hardware failures, issues with drivers, or serious software bugs that undermine the stability of the operating system.

Update Your Device Drivers

Update Your Device Drivers Thumbnail
Difficulty
Advanced
Steps
8
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
4
Description

How to guide on updating the device drivers on your system. unlodctr.exe errors can be caused by outdated or incompatible drivers.

Step 1: Open Device Manager

Step 1: Open Device Manager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Device Manager in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update Thumbnail
  1. In the Device Manager window, locate the device whose driver you want to update.

  2. Click on the arrow or plus sign next to the device category to expand it.

  3. Right-click on the device and select Update driver.

Step 3: Update the Driver

Step 3: Update the Driver Thumbnail
  1. In the next window, select Search automatically for updated driver software.

  2. Follow the prompts to install the driver update.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. After the driver update is installed, restart your computer.
